Discover the Viaur Viaduct

Tauriac-de-Naucelle

Completed in 1902, this railway bridge - listed among the Historical Monuments in France - cross the valley where the Viaur River runs. Imagined by Engineer Paul Bodin, this steel-made masterpiece will surprise you with its apparent lightness!

Explore Baraqueville

Baraqueville

Settled in a Segala ridge, this small modern town owes its creation and expansion to its geographical location, which gave it - and still gives it - the opportunity to play a major role in the area economy for agriculture.

Explore Castelmary - fortified area

Castelmary

Medieval settlement of one barony out of the 12 that existed in the Rouergue, it is today a protected site in the Aveyron : you will be amazed by this hamlet and its castle overlooking the Lézert gorges and its meanders down from its rocky spur!
